How they compare

New Caledonia currently reports 2,130 1000 USD against 1,940 1000 USD in Gambia, a difference of 190 1000 USD.

That makes New Caledonia's figure about 1.1 times Gambia's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 22 shared years of data; in 1997 it was New Caledonia ahead.

Gambia ranks 67th and New Caledonia ranks 65th of 159 countries.

New Caledonia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
